The Femtosecond Laser
Historically, traditional LASIK surgical procedure utilized a mechanical cutting tool called a microkeratome to develop a hinged flap on the cornea. The surgeon after that folded up back the flap to access the eye's underlying tissue. The specialist then made use of an excimer laser to improve the corneal cells, dealing with refractive errors like nearsightedness as well as farsightedness.
The femtosecond laser utilized for LASIK procedures uses significant advantages over traditional tools, consisting of enhanced safety and security, better recovery, and exact results. The femtosecond laser's powerful pulses of light interfere with the corneal cells in a precisely controlled manner.
The femtosecond laser's wise energy control additionally allows surgeons to track eye motion 200 times per 2nd, which guarantees that every laser pulse is completely precise. This allows cosmetic surgeons to do excellent lamellar as well as penetrating keratoplasties in addition to clear corneal incisions, cataract surgical procedure, as well as more. The result is an individualized treatment that supplies clients with exceptional visual outcomes. The IntraLase Flap
The first step of the LASIK procedure involves developing a flap on the corneal epithelial surface area. Commonly this was performed with a hand-held bladed instrument called the microkeratome. Considering that the microkeratome makes physical contact with your eye, it can introduce a component of threat to the surgical treatment.
The femtosecond laser is much more secure for this essential first step of the LASIK procedure due to the fact that it does not make physical contact with your eye. Rather the femtosecond laser develops a pattern of microscopic bubbles beneath the corneal surface that after that link to create the flap.
This new method enables the surgeon to establish accurate parameters for the flap density, depth and hinge area. This supplies the surgeon with a high level of personalization that eliminates difficulties connected with the flap and also makes sure a much more effective LASIK end result. It additionally enables even more people with thin corneas, who were rejected as LASIK candidates in the past, to get the treatment and appreciate enhanced vision.
The SMILE Procedure
The FDA has actually simply authorized a new refractive surgical treatment procedure that is a different to LASIK called small cut lenticule removal (SMILE). It is a remarkable laser therapy option for people with nearsightedness, or nearsightedness.
During the SMILE treatment, a Visumax femtosecond laser creates pulses that will specify and also develop a summary of a thin lens-shaped piece of corneal cells, called a lenticule. The doctor after that produces a keyhole incision on the corneal surface area, as well as eliminates the lenticule to reshape the cornea and right vision.
The truth that SMILE does not require a flap may help to reduce completely dry eye symptoms after the treatment, and also it also shows up that the tiny lenticule incision creates much less damages to the corneal nerves, bring about far better biomechanical stability over time. These benefits, along with the reality that SMILE treats a more comprehensive series of nearsightedness issues than keratomileusis does, make SMILE an appealing alternative for numerous patients.
The Excimer Laser
The excimer laser makes use of ultraviolet radiation to change the corneal shape, decreasing refractive mistakes such as nearsightedness (nearsightedness), hyperopia (farsightedness) and also astigmatism. It is one of the most vital piece of equipment in Lasik surgery and also the trick to eliminating your dependency on glasses and call lenses.
